SoloCodigo

Programación Web y Scripting => PHP => Mensaje iniciado por: aguilaoro en Viernes 16 de Noviembre de 2007, 18:55

Título: Enviar Los Datos A Una Base De Datos
Publicado por: aguilaoro en Viernes 16 de Noviembre de 2007, 18:55
:comp: hola a todos, necesito su ayuda porque estoy trabajando en una pagina web en la que estoy utilizando botones de opcion, y cuando selecciono uno para enviar una una base de datos no se envia me marca error, por eso sera que puedan ayudarme o que tenga un codigo paresido para que funcione.
Aqui les mando el archivo para que chequen en que estoy trabajando
:comp:
Título: Re: Enviar Los Datos A Una Base De Datos
Publicado por: RadicalEd en Viernes 16 de Noviembre de 2007, 19:48
Y donde está el archivo prueba22.php, para ver como estás recibiendo los datos.
Título: Re: Enviar Los Datos A Una Base De Datos
Publicado por: aguilaoro en Sábado 17 de Noviembre de 2007, 00:43
:comp: hola amigo, este es el otro archivo prueba22.php lo estoy modificando, por eso esta como esta ok. :comp: [/size]
Título: Re: Enviar Los Datos A Una Base De Datos
Publicado por: venedan en Sábado 17 de Noviembre de 2007, 02:55
por lo que pude ver estas enviando mal las variables a la base de datos lo que hicistes fue

values('".$_POST["grado1"]. + .$_POST["traba1"]."','".$_POST["grado2"]. + .$_POST["traba2"]."',

y esa no es la forma tienes un poco de comillas simples y dobles y puntos que ni idea y de paso estas usando concatenacion no se por que motivo pero bueno lo correcto seria de este modo

values('$_POST[grado1]','$_POST[traba1]','$_POST[grado3]','$_POST[traba2]')
Título: Re: Enviar Los Datos A Una Base De Datos
Publicado por: RadicalEd en Sábado 17 de Noviembre de 2007, 13:39
Cita de: "venedan"
por lo que pude ver estas enviando mal las variables a la base de datos lo que hicistes fue

values('".$_POST["grado1"]. + .$_POST["traba1"]."','".$_POST["grado2"]. + .$_POST["traba2"]."',

y esa no es la forma tienes un poco de comillas simples y dobles y puntos que ni idea y de paso estas usando concatenacion no se por que motivo pero bueno lo correcto seria de este modo

values('$_POST[grado1]','$_POST[traba1]','$_POST[grado3]','$_POST[traba2]')
<!--php1--></div><table border='0' align='center' width='95%' cellpadding='3' cellspacing='1'><tr><td>PHP </td></tr><tr><td id='CODE'><!--ephp1--><code>[color= #000000]

values('".$_POST[grado1].$_POST[traba1]."','".$_POST[grado3].$_POST[traba2]."')[/color]
[/color]
</code><!--php2--></td></tr></table><div class='postcolor'><!--ephp2-->
Ten en cuenta venedan que él está concatenando las variables grado con las variables traba, ya que son un dato para un campo en la tabla, la forma de concatenar variables es con el punto ( . ), realmente no le encuentro mucha lógica a tú código aguilaoro.[/size]
Título: Re: Enviar Los Datos A Una Base De Datos
Publicado por: aguilaoro en Martes 20 de Noviembre de 2007, 17:54
:comp: gracias por su ayuda :comp: [/size]